[SCREENSHOT INCLUDED] Which of the following is the best estimate of f '(2) based on this table of values?
mel-nik [20]

Using derivatives, it is found that the best estimate of f '(2) based on this table of values is of 10.

The rate of change <u>from x = 0 to x = 2</u> is given by:

r_1 = \frac{2 - (-16)}{2 - 0} = \frac{18}{2} = 9

From <u>x = 2 to x = 4</u>, it is given by:

r_2 = \frac{24 - 2}{4 - 2} = \frac{22}{2} = 11

The average of these rates is:

A = \frac{r_1 + r_2}{2} = \frac{9 + 11}{2} = 10

Hence, the best estimate of f '(2) based on this table of values is of 10.

Which expression is equivalent to the product of p+7/3 and 6/p , where p is not equal to 0?
vichka [17]

Answer:

\frac{(6p+14)}{p}

Step-by-step explanation:

(p+\frac{7}{3})(\frac{6}{p})

Making denominator same in first bracket we get

(\frac{3p+7}{3})(\frac{6}{p})

(\frac{(3p+7)*6}{3*p})

Dividing 6 by 3 we get 2

(\frac{(3p+7)*2}{p})

using distributive law

(\frac{6p+14}{p})\\

Hence this is our answer
